## Step 4: Point GraphLoom at the new renderer

Heads up: GraphLoom 3.0 drops the old dot-based backend, so the dependency graph visualizer now talks to the Skein render service directly. Before you cut the release, make sure the staging cluster at Norvale has the renderer flag enabled, or graphs will silently come back empty. The values below should land in your release config as-is.

deployment values, faduf-tawep:
SORDOR_LOG_LEVEL=error
SORDOR_METRICS_HOST=metrics.sordor.nelvrolabs.internal
SORDOR_POOL_SIZE=4

## Releases

Chalkplan, the school timetable solver, publishes releases quarterly, timed before each term. Support staff should direct schools to the latest tagged build only; older solvers may produce schedules incompatible with current import formats. Each release bundle includes the binary, a changelog, and a signature file. If a school reports an installation warning, have them verify the bundle against our release signing key, shown below.

deploy key for kajof-fajop: bky6_gDHw9Q

## Changelog — Parcelhorn webhook defaults

For this week's sync: we changed the default behaviour of the Parcelhorn tracking webhook. Retries now back off exponentially instead of fixed intervals, delivery timeouts dropped from 30s to 10s, and unsigned payloads are rejected rather than logged. Existing subscribers on the Tollgate depot integration were migrated automatically; nobody else should notice. The old defaults remain available via an override flag until next quarter. The new effective defaults are as follows.

settings of yageg-yahap:
[gorael]
team = olieth
access_code = ac_941d74
owner = brieth.aldiel
host = gorael.tolvaqio.internal
port = 6379
peer = briwyn.urlaqtech.internal
salt = 116e6622
pin = 1957